本文主要介绍了宁晋资深iOS开发工程师对深度学习在iOS开发中的应用和技术分享。深度学习在人工智能领域的应用越来越广泛,本文为iOS开发者提供了从基础理论到实际操作应用的详细指导,帮助开发者快速掌握深度学习在iOS开发中的应用技巧和方法。
1. 深度学习的基础理论与模型
深度学习在iOS应用开发中扮演着越来越重要的角色。本文从概念出发,逐步介绍了深度学习的基础理论和模型,包括神经网络、卷积神经网络、循环神经网络等。介绍了深度学习的常见任务,如图像识别、自然语言处理和语音识别。同时,本文也介绍了深度学习框架的选择和使用,帮助开发者快速掌握深度学习的基础知识。
2. 深度学习在iOS系统中的实现
深度学习在iOS开发中的应用和实现方式有多种,本文着重介绍了在iOS系统中使用Core ML框架和TensorFlow Lite框架的方法和技巧。通过实际应用案例的分析,探讨了深度学习在iOS系统中的运行效率和优化方法,如量化和转换等。同时,本文还介绍了深度学习在移动设备上的部署和更新方式,帮助开发者更好地理解深度学习在iOS系统中的应用方式。
3. 深度学习在iOS应用中的具体应用
深度学习在iOS应用中的具体应用有很多,本文以图像识别和自然语言处理为例,介绍了深度学习在iOS应用中的应用场景和技术方法。通过实际案例的分析,介绍了在iOS应用中使用深度学习进行图像识别和自然语言处理的技巧和方法。同时,本文也探讨了深度学习在iOS应用中的发展前景和挑战。
4. 深度学习在iOS游戏开发中的运用
深度学习在iOS游戏开发中的应用也越来越广泛。本文着重介绍了深度学习在iOS游戏开发中的运用和应用方式,包括动态场景生成、智能升级、用户行为分析等。通过实际案例的分析,深入探讨了在iOS游戏开发中使用深度学习的应用场景和技术方法。同时,本文也指出了深度学习在iOS游戏开发中的挑战和未来发展方向。
5. 深度学习与iOS开发的未来
深度学习在iOS开发中的应用和发展前景越来越广泛。本文指出了深度学习与iOS开发的未来,包括深度学习在iOS开发中的普及和使用、深度学习与其他新兴技术的结合,以及深度学习在iOS系统中的性能和效率的不断提高。同时,本文呼吁更多iOS开发者参与深度学习的应用和研究,共同推动人工智能和移动应用的发展。
本文详细介绍了深度学习在iOS开发中的应用和技术分享,从基础理论到具体应用,全面阐述了深度学习在iOS开发中的应用和发展前景。同时,也希望更多开发者参与深度学习的应用和研究,共同推动人工智能和移动应用的发展。
文章介绍了宁晋资深教授关于深度学习iOS开发的分享。本文从深度学习概念入手,详细解析了iOS开发中常用的深度学习框架,并着重介绍了如何在iOS平台上使用深度学习实现图像识别、语音识别等应用。文章深入浅出、内容详实,是学习深度学习iOS开发的必读之选。
1. 深度学习概念解析
深度学习是一种机器学习的领域,其目标是让机器能够像人一样进行分析、学习和执行任务。本段落介绍了深度学习的三个核心概念:神经网络、反向传播和卷积神经网络。同时,在介绍了深度学习的基本原理之后,本段落还解释了深度学习的优势和应用场景。
2. 常用的深度学习框架
深度学习框架是实现深度学习算法的重要工具。本段落着重介绍了在iOS开发中常用的深度学习框架:TensorFlow和Keras。文中详细解释了这两款框架的特点和优缺点,以及如何在iOS平台下实现深度学习应用。
3. 深度学习在iOS图像识别中的应用
深度学习在图像识别方面具有较出色的表现。本段落介绍了如何使用深度学习实现iOS中的图片分类和物体识别。文中还详细介绍了数据集的获取和预处理方法,并给出了一些图像识别应用的实际例子。
4. 深度学习在iOS语音识别中的应用
语音识别是深度学习在iOS开发领域中的另一个重要应用。本段落介绍了如何使用深度学习实现iOS中的语音识别,以及如何利用Core ML框架将深度学习模型整合到iOS开发中。同时,文中还介绍了常见的语音识别问题及其解决方案。
5. 深度学习在iOS中的未来发展
本段落主要从两个方面探讨了深度学习在iOS中的未来发展。一方面,随着iOS设备性能的提升,深度学习应用在iOS上的推广和应用会更加广泛。另一方面,由于隐私和存储等问题,深度学习框架在iOS平台上的发展可能会面临更多的挑战。